Ballston Spa is a compact, walkable village with a friendly downtown of local shops, cafes, and historic buildings that many residents enjoy for casual errands and evening strolls. The community feels connected and active, with parks, community organizations, and occasional events that draw neighbors together. People often appreciate the quieter pace here while still having easy access to everyday conveniences and recreational green spaces.
For those considering relocation, housing choices range from charming older homes and duplexes to smaller apartment options, offering a range of living arrangements without overwhelming complexity. Commuting to nearby employment and cultural centers is straightforward by car or short transit links, and the village's sidewalks, bike-friendly routes, and nearby trails make it convenient to get around without relying solely on a vehicle.

Final February 2026 market snapshot: Ballston Spa, NY’s home values and market activity summary.
As February 2026 concludes, Ballston Spa, NY continues to present a robust, fast-paced housing scene. Which factors have defined the market this month—and what should you expect as we look ahead?
For those seeking affordable homes in Ballston Spa, NY this February 2026, every decision has been shaped by tight inventory and rising values. Jessica Hurta uses recent data to guide strategies, making every sale or purchase informed, intentional, and timely for her clients.
Median sold price closed the month at $475,000, with a 9.2 percent rise from last month. Median estimated property value landed at $428,940, up 5.9 percent year-over-year. New listings averaged $482,400 and actives held strong at a $600,000 median. Median price per square foot in sales now stands at $278. Why does this matter? These numbers confirm solid equity gains for owners and a confident footing for buyers entering the market at any level.
